Product Overview

These paediatric electrode pads for the Schiller FRED Easy and Easy Life are designed for use on child and infant patients aged between 1 to 8 years old or weighing less than 25kg. When connected to your Schiller defibrillator, the paediatric pads reduce the shock energy delivered from 150 to 70 joules. The Schiller FRED Easy pads are supplied pre-gelled for application in a sealed pack which features a diagram showing exactly where the pads should be positioned on the young patient.

  • Suitable for use with the Schiller FRED Easy and Easy Life defibrillator units
  • Designed for the treatment of young patients (aged 1 to 8 years old or less than 25kg)
  • Supplied as a pair in a sealed pack
  • Can be stored as a spare pack or to replace expired/used pads
  • A pictorial guide on the packaging helps with correct pad positioning
  • Supplied with up to 30 months' lifespan
